37-1) 5-Hydroxymethyl-1-decylimidazole The title compound was obtained in a yield of 52percent according to the same procedure as Preparation 31-1) using dihydroxyacetone and decylamine hydrochloride as starting materials. 1H NMR(CDCl3) delta0.88(t, 3H), 1.04(brs, 2H), 1.30(brs, 14H), 1.42(m, 2H), 3.68(t, 2H), 4.23(brs, 1H), 4.60(s, 2H), 6.84(s, 1H), 7.44(s, 1H) |
